Liverpool maintained their 100% start to the Premier League season with a 3-1 win over Arsenal at Anfield and whilst there were plenty of outstanding moments from Saturday’s game, one in particular has gone viral on social media.
Roberto Firmino was in great form in the game and was looking full of confidence. Late in the second half, he produced a lovely bit of skill to chip the ball over Dani Ceballos before having a strike at goal.
